Which equation has the solutions x = (5 +- 2 \sqrt(7))/(3)?

Mathematics
2 answers:
asambeis [7]3 years ago
8 0
Recall the formula to find the solutions for an equation ax² + bx + c:
x₁₂ = (- b +/- √(b²-4ac) )/ 2a

Since at the denominator of our solution we have 3, which is an odd number, therefore it cannot be 2a, but only a, we should use the formula:

x₁₂ = <span>(-β +/- √(β²-ac) )/ a

Where </span>β = b/2

Hence, the only options that have an even number as b coefficient are C and D.

Now, we need to find what values give √(β² - ac) = 2√7 = √(4·7) = √28:

C) √(β² - ac) = √(25 - 3·6) = √7
D) √(β² - ac) = <span>√(25 - 3·(-1))</span> = √28

Hence, the correct answer is D) 3x² - 10x - 1 = 0

A cat keeps eating to gain weight while a dog keeps doing exercise.Later, the cat's weight increases by 20% and the dog's weight
lesya [120]

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

We will call the dog's original weight d and the cat's c.  according to the problem 1.2c=.9d

1.2c is the cat's weight increased by 20% and .9d is the dog's weight decreased by 10%  Now we just solve this with algebra for the dog's original weight.

1.2c=.9d

(1.2/.9)c = d

(4/3)c = d

Now, this tells us that the dog's original weight was 4/3 of the cat's.or  about 33.33% larger

It kinda looks like the question is then asking what the cat's current weight is  in comparison to the dog's original.  If that's the case we need just one more step.  We want the dog's original weight and the cat's current weight in terms of the same variable.  Well, we have that.  

Current cat = 1.2c or 6/5, since we have the other in fractional form.

original dog = (4/3)c  

Now, what do we multiply the first to get to the second?  Well, we need common denominators.  15 is the lcm of 3 and 5, so we'll use that.

6/5 = 18/15 and 4/3 = 20/15

Nowwe want to know what we have to multiply 18 by to get to 20.  some algebra will find that.

18x=20

x = 20/18

x = 10/9

that's about 1.11, so the dog's original weight is about 11% higher than the cat's current weight.
